Understanding the Estate Sale Process

An estate sale involves selling a significant portion of a homeowner's belongings, often conducted on-site. It can be due to various reasons such as relocation, financial needs, or the passing of a loved one. Knowing the steps and having a plan can make a substantial difference in your experience and outcome.
 

Plan Ahead

1. Assess Your Assets

Start by evaluating the items you intend to sell. This includes everything from jewelry and antiques to furniture and art. Make an inventory list and consider which items hold sentimental value and which you can part with.

2. Determine Value

Researching the current market value of your items is a critical step. Online resources and appraisal services can help determine what your possessions are worth. Engaging with an experienced estate buyer, like HJ Coins & Jewelry, can provide you with an accurate valuation.

3. Set Clear Goals

Decide what you want to achieve with your sale. Is your primary aim to clear out the estate quickly, or are you looking to maximize profit? Setting clear goals will help guide your decisions throughout the process.

Preparing for the Estate Sale

Preparation is key to a successful estate sale. Here are some steps to ensure everything goes smoothly:

Organize Your Items

1. Clean and Repair

Present your items in the best possible condition. Clean and make minor repairs where necessary to enhance their appeal and value.

2. Group Similar Items

Organize items into categories, such as kitchenware, clothing, and collectibles. This helps potential buyers easily find what they're interested in and can lead to higher sales.

Advertise Your Event

1. Use Multiple Channels

Promote your estate sale through various platforms. Social media, local newspapers, and community bulletin boards can help spread the word and attract more buyers.

2. Highlight Unique Items

Attract attention by showcasing your most unique or valuable items in your advertising. Including pictures and detailed descriptions can pique potential buyers' interest.
 

The Day of the Sale

On the day of the sale, creating a welcoming environment is essential. Here are some tips to enhance the buyer experience:

Set the Scene

1. Create a Comfortable Atmosphere

Ensure your sale area is clean, well-lit, and easy to navigate. Providing refreshments and music can make the event more enjoyable for attendees.

2. Price Clearly

Make sure all items are clearly priced. Consider using color-coded stickers for different pricing categories to simplify the process.

Engage with Buyers

1. Be Available

Be present and approachable during the sale. Answer questions, provide information about the items, and be open to negotiations.

2. Offer Bundles or Discounts

Encourage more sales by offering discounts for bulk purchases or towards the end of the event. Flexible pricing can help clear out more items.
 

Post-Sale Tips

After your estate sale, there are a few final steps to wrap up the process effectively:

Evaluate Your Results

1. Review Sales Performance

Assess which items sold well and which did not. This information is valuable if you plan to conduct another sale in the future or need to approach your estate buyer again.

2. Manage Unsold Items

Decide what to do with any unsold items. Consider donating to charity, selling online, or reaching out to your estate buyer for further assistance.
